 Spoleto USA: A World of Culture in Historic Charleston SC

Over 30 years ago, Spoleto USA began as the American counterpart to the Festival of Two Worlds held in Spoleto, Italy. Since then, the annual, 17-day festival has grown into a truly major cultural event, hosting over 100 world premieres and 93 American premieres.

Today, Charleston's Spoleto Festival USA continues to bring the world of culture to the Low Country, and there's something for almost every taste, including:  Opera, Classical Music, Choral, Jazz, Dance, Theater and Visual Arts.

There’s an Artistic Buzz in the Air

The impact on Charleston and the Low Country is tremendous. Throughout the festival, restaurants, hotels and tourist attractions are crowded with visitors. The energy and excitement up and down Charleston's narrow streets is unlike any other time of the year.

For some, it's an inconvenience. For others, however, it's a time to put their Charleston pride on display! Each May/June, downtown residents have become accustomed to sharing their quiet southern town with the world. It's a time of entertaining, garden parties and home tours.  This is when you truly see that culture is not only an event, but a lifestyle!
